Overview

The Agency of Human Services seeks a highly organized and proactive Staff Assistant to join the Office of the Secretary. This role is essential to the success of the office, directly supporting Deputy Secretary and Medicaid Director by managing scheduling, information flow, and document retention. The Staff Assistant will also provide support at public events and meetings, assist with managing review and approvals for administrative rules, legislative reports, and other critical documents.

Work may also include staffing senior agency leaders at meetings and events (including taking notes / minutes and capturing follow up items) and some travel around Vermont.

This key role reports to and is supervised by the Principal Assistant, directly supports and works closely with the Deputy Secretary and Medicaid Director, and works closely with the Secretary of Human Services, their Executive Assistant, and other colleagues in the Office of the Secretary.

This role is classified as an Administrative Services Manager I in the Vermont Department of Human Resources classification system.

AHS BACKGROUND CHECKS:
Candidates must pass any level of background investigation applicable to the position. In accordance with AHS Policy 4.02, Hiring Standards, Vermont and/or national criminal record checks, as well as DMV and adult and child abuse registry checks, as appropriate to the position under recruitment, will be conducted on candidates, with the exception of those who are current classified state employees seeking transfer, promotion or demotion into an AHS classified position or are persons exercising re-employment (RIF) rights.

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in accounting, business or public administration, office administration or a related field and two years of experience providing professional administrative-level services to a business or organization which included an accounting or budgeting function and experience as a supervisor of clerical or administrative staff;
  • Bachelor's degree and four years of experience providing professional administrative-level services to a business or organization which included an accounting or budgeting function and experience as a supervisor of clerical or administrative staff;
  • One year as an Administrative Services Coordinator IV with the State of Vermont.

NOTE:

Additional professional administrative-level experience or higher will substitute for the bachelor's degree on a year for year basis.

NOTE:

Only administrative work experience is qualifying. Administrative services includes those functions which keep the organization running or provide the resources for others to provide the programmatic work (e.g., accounting, budget management, grant administration, finance, human resources, payroll, purchasing, or space management).

Special Requirements

For some positions experience working with the VISION system (VISION is the State of Vermont People Soft financial management system) may be required.
